In panties in front of the mirror in her bathroom, Ashley Graham strikes a pose.
In a triptych of photos shared on her Instagram account, the top with 17 million subscribers reveals this Sunday, April 24, the reality of postpartum.
The left arm armed with the phone and the other hiding her breasts, she reveals her still very round belly and the stretch marks that cover it.
These marks are those left by her delivery, three months earlier, of her twins Malachi and Roman, born on January 7.

"Hi, New Belly"
With these pictures, the model and undisputed ambassador of the body positive movement intends to shed light on childbirth and its consequences.
According to her, these body changes are normal and should not be stigmatized.
“Hi, new belly.
We have been through a lot.
Thank you.
#3moispostpartum”, she wrote in the caption.
In the comments, many users of the social network welcomed this gesture.
"It's always so refreshing to see women's bodies in their raw state, without filters and in all their glory," testifies a surfer.
“The lives that you have created, carried and pushed into this world are incredible,” assures another.
“This belly has the most beautiful and healthiest stories to tell”, summarizes a subscriber.

Maternity soap opera
This isn't the first time Ashley Graham has shown off her body transformations on Instagram.
In early December, the plus-size model posted a photo of her belly marbling with streaks, referring in her caption to her hubby: "Justin says my stretch marks look like the tree of life."
After giving birth, the American also published pictures of her daily life as a mother on March 22.
We see her express her milk, breastfeed one of her infants or even show a stain of rising milk on her gray garment.
There is no doubt that motherhood no longer has any taboos for her.
